My son attended the CRU Galston Gorge Camp this past weekend, and overall, it was a solid experience. The instructors, particularly a friendly guy named Jake, were very engaging and kept the kids active with various outdoor activities like hiking and team-building games. My son built a small shelter with his group, which he thoroughly enjoyed and even made a new friend in the process. The camp's natural setting is beautiful, and it provided a nice escape from city life. However, we faced some long lines during check-in, which was a bit frustrating, especially after a long drive from Sydney. Despite that minor annoyance, I would recommend this camp for active kids who love exploring nature. My son came home excited about his experiences and eager to return, which is a win in my book.

We recently attended the overnight Nature & Outdoors program at CRU Galston Gorge Camp in Sydney with my 9-year-old daughter. She had a fantastic time exploring the trails and engaging in team-building activities. The instructor, Jake, was particularly enthusiastic and kept the kids engaged throughout the weekend. My daughter built a birdhouse, which she was incredibly proud of, and even made a new friend, which was a bonus. The only downside was the long lines during check-in, which could have been better organized. Overall, it was a solid experience, combining fun and learning in nature. I would recommend it for active kids who love being outdoors!
